AMP

AMP?

Is it an audio manipulation program? No, not at all.  It is actually a new media player from Adobe.  AMP stands for - you guessed it - Adobe Media Player.  Although their name wasn't the most creative, the features Adobe packed into the application truly are useful and in some cases, original.

The program supports watching videos from online and from your hard drive, and downloading videos.  The installation on a Mac is easy as pie: Using the pre-installed Adobe software, it shows you 1 prompt, and downloads the app into yur Aplications folder on your boot drive.  It supports DRM and HD content, so everyone will be pleased.

Another thing that will certainly please is the wide variety of current and coming material. Content from publishers such as CBS and MTV Networks has already been posted, and material from Comedy Central and Spike will come in the near future.
